Output 93f0d025fb180c21c564ba579b5b289d697f60d43f8dee7ae128dffe61643432:1

value
13192200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42d8870638f42dde923315720290bae3a39f66f OP_EQUAL
address
3NVWXy36DPragAZUUYgQuCo9wdSmECndQW
transaction
93f0d025fb180c21c564ba579b5b289d697f60d43f8dee7ae128dffe61643432
confirmations
415376
spent
true